Paradeep Phosphates’ Goa plants resume operations (19-09-2024)
Paradeep Phosphates informed that its ammonia and urea plants at Goa have now resumed the production.

Atishi’s new team: Mukesh Ahlawat to be new face in Delhi cabinet; check other names in Council of Ministers (19-09-2024)
Aam Aadmi Party leader Atishi will be sworn in as Delhi’s new Chief Minister on September 21. The party has announced a cabinet reshuffle, including Mukesh Ahlawat as a new member. Current ministers Gopal Rai, Kailash Gehlot, Saurabh Bharadwaj, and Imran Hussain have been retained, though their portfolios may change.

Laurus Labs Ltd drops for fifth straight session (19-09-2024)
Laurus Labs Ltd is quoting at Rs 463.95, down 4.42% on the day as on 13:19 IST on the NSE. The stock jumped 17.43% in last one year as compared to a 27.59% rally in NIFTY and a 47.81% spurt in the Nifty Pharma index.
Nibe shoots for the stars with satellite constellation (19-09-2024)
Nibe Space (NSPL), a subsidiary of Nibe, announced its vision to establish India’s first multi-sensor, all-weather, high-revisit Earth observation satellite constellation. Aiming to strengthen India’s self-reliance in the strategically crucial defence-space sector, NSPL signed memoranda of agreement with Indian and global partners, including Larsen and Toubro, Centum, AgniKul, Skyroot Aerospace, SpaceFields, SISIR Radar, CYRAN AI Solutions, and Thales Alenia Space as a technology partner.
